Ticket #— Floor 9 Opening Prep, Brindlemoor House

Hi facilities folks, Floor 9 opens to staff next Monday and we need a few things squared away before then. Lift access is live, but the two side doors by the kitchenette are still on the old lock config — please reprogram them before Friday. Also, signage for the quiet rooms hasn't arrived, so pop up the temporary printed ones for now. Until the badge readers sync, the interim door code for Floor 9 is below.

door code, bajop-bajog: bdg-DSWAC-43621

# CSV Import Wizard — Limits and Quotas

Welcome aboard! Before you wire anything into the Sheetloaf import wizard, know that it's deliberately cautious. Uploads above the row cap get chunked automatically, and anything past the hard ceiling is rejected with a friendly error. Column counts, cell sizes, and retry windows all have caps too — mostly to protect the parser pool from one giant messy file. Don't raise these without pinging the platform crew. Current values are below.

tuning constants:
QUOTAS = {
    "druwyn": 5,
    "holix": 5,
    "zorath": 5,
    "holwyn": 10,
}

**Ticket: Thumbnail queue backlog fix — needs sign-off**

Hey, quick one before the Friday cut. The thumbnail generation queue on Pixelbarn was choking on oversized uploads, so we added a pre-resize step and bumped worker concurrency from 4 to 8. Backlog drained from ~40k jobs to under 200 in staging. No schema changes, just config and one worker patch. We'd like this in the 3.2 release train if possible. Rollback is a one-line config revert. Sign-off needed from the owner below.

approver of yajef-fajef = Oliwyn Silion Kasok Kasox

Subject: Prototype units to Marlowe Bench Labs

Hi dispatch,

We're sending three prototype units of the Ferrow-9 controller to Marlowe Bench Labs tomorrow morning. Units are in the padded black case on rack 4; warehouse shift lead will bring it down at 08:00. Case stays sealed — no inspection en route. Courier is booked through Ashgrove Priority for a 09:15 collection at dock 2. Signature and photo of the intact seal required at drop-off. Release the case only after the rider quotes this phrase:

courier memo of yawep-yafog: the pramir ulaix courier leaves the ulavan aldix frair zorok oliiel joreth rusdor fenvan ledger at gate 1305 under passcode 514738